highboy US
ˈhaɪˌbɔɪ
See also: tallboy (UK)
Definition Synonyms

Definition of highboy - Reverso English Dictionary

Noun

furnitureRareUStall chest of drawers in two sectionsRareUS
  • She stored her clothes in the elegant highboy.
  • The antique highboy was the centerpiece of the room.
  • He inherited a highboy that had been in the family for generations.
